The section tests your ability to understand complex written passages, analyze them, and answer questions based on the\u00a0<\/span><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">information provided. The reading comprehension section is designed to assess your critical thinking, reasoning, and comprehension skills. You should pay attention to the author&#8217;s tone, purpose, and attitude towards the topic. Analyze the passage beyond the surface level and identify the author&#8217;s perspective and argument. This <\/span><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">will help you to answer the questions based on a deeper understanding of the passage.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\"><strong>Eliminating Options<\/strong><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">In the GMAT RC section, you will be given multiple-choice questions, and sometimes, the answer options may seem quite similar. To avoid getting confused and choosing the wrong answer, try eliminating the clearly wrong options. By doing so, you increase your chances of selecting the correct answer. There is nothing better than being sure about the four <\/span><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">incorrect options to a question.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\"><strong>Don&#8217;t Overthink Inferences<\/strong><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Inferences are assumptions that you make based on the information presented in the passage. While making inferences is a critical component of the RC section, it&#8217;s important not to overthink or read too much into the text. Stick to the information provided in the passage and avoid making assumptions based on your personal opinions or beliefs. Also, keep track of the time you take for inference-based questions because they usually take more time than other questions and can make or break your VR section because of the time they take to solve.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\"><strong>Solve Good Quality RCs<\/strong><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">When preparing for the GMAT RC section, it&#8217;s very essential to practice with quality RCs. Try Reading for Pleasure.<\/strong><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">To improve your RC skills, you need to develop a reading habit. Try reading various materials, including newspapers, magazines, and books. This will help you to develop your reading speed, comprehension skills, and vocabulary. You should start by reading what you enjoy the most. This will develop a good reading habit, make reading a more enjoyable experience, and you will be more likely to continue reading regularly. This will make the tedious passages of the GMAT look much easier to read.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Things to Avoid\u00a0<\/span><\/strong><\/h2>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">While there are effective strategies to improve your GMAT RC skills, there are also some gimmicks that you should avoid. Skimming the Passage Instead of Reading the Passage<\/span><\/strong><\/h4>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">One of the most common gimmicks is to skim the passage instead of reading it thoroughly. Some test-takers believe that by skimming, they can save time and still understand the passage. However, skimming may lead to missing essential details, which could affect your <\/span><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">comprehension and performance on the questions.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">2. Reading the Concluding Paragraph First<\/span><\/strong><\/h4>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Another gimmick is reading the concluding paragraph before reading the rest of the passage. While the concluding paragraph may provide some insight into the author&#8217;s argument, it&#8217;s not enough to understand the full context of the passage. Reading the concluding paragraph first may also bias your interpretation of the passage.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">3. Reading the Questions First and Then Trying to Read the Passage<\/span><\/strong><\/h4>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Some test-takers also try to read the questions first and then read the passage, hoping to find the answers more easily. While this helps sometimes, it is not always useful because it may lead to missing critical details and cause confusion when answering the questions. Moreover, the <\/span><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">questions are designed to test your comprehension of the entire passage, so reading the passage thoroughly before attempting the questions is essential.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">The GMAT RC section can be challenging, but with the right strategies and consistent practice, you can surely improve your performance.\u00a0<\/span><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Remember to read between the lines, answer by eliminating options, avoid overthinking inferences, solve quality questions, and develop a reading habit.\u00a0<\/span><\/strong><\/p>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Following these tips can improve your RC skills and increase your chances of achieving a high GMAT score.
